DESCRIPTION

The Pre-Litigated File Handler will run and maintain their own caseload of up to 250 pre-litigated files to conclusion or the point of litigation. The successful candidate will undertake a variety of tasks on pre-litigated files to ensure all Client KPI’s and SLA’s are met. This role would be ideal for a candidate who is looking for experience running their own NIHL caseload.

Responsibilities
  • Maintain a caseload of approximately 250 NIHL files
  • Completion of Tracker Strategy document
  • Sending out Initial Letters and completing initial file opening procedures upon receipt of new files
  • Companies Searches and ELTO Searches
  • Director searches and letters
  • Instructions to investigators
  • Telephone/email chasers to claimant solicitors, insurance companies and brokers for HMRC Schedule, medical evidence, mandates and updates.
  • General admin including diarising dates for Protocol expiry
  • Escalation of files to Team Leader for review when key milestones triggered
  • Updating database on VF / Tracker
  • Policy queries to client for insured
  • Requesting documents from Insurer
  • Request and review OH & Personnel records from insured
  • Review medical, engineering evidence and witness evidence.
  • File Closure
  • Notifying brokers and co-defendants of closure
  • General admin - diary dates
  • Undertake ad hoc duties to support the team as required
  • To ensure compliance with the SRA Standards & Regulations
